What to do in Manchester, Tennessee, United States of America
Manchester, Tennessee is a charming city nestled in the heart of the southern state. It boasts a rich history spanning centuries with a diverse culture to match. From the picturesque countryside to cultural hotspots, here are some of the top tourist attractions in Manchester, Tennessee, the United States of America.
Bonnaroo Music & Arts Festival:
Perhaps, the largest attraction in Manchester is the Bonnaroo Music & Arts Festival. The annual event showcases an impressive lineup of artists across a range of genres. People from all over the world flock here to bask in the tunes, art installations, and diverse community during the festival.
Old Stone Fort State Archaeological Park:
The Old Stone Fort State Archaeological Park offers visitors a glimpse into the ancient past with preserved Native American architecture. The park features hiking trails, picnic areas, and a visitor center to inform visitors about the history of the region.
Tullahoma Campaign Civil War Trail:
The Tullahoma Campaign Civil War Trail is a must-visit attraction for history buffs. The trail offers a driving experience that takes visitors through the Civil War’s Tullahoma Campaign that happened at the base of the Cumberland Plateau.
Cascade Hollow Distilling Co.:
If you're a fan of whiskey, the Cascade Hollow Distilling Co. is an excellent place to visit. The heritage distillery offers tours and tastings, immersing visitors in the craft of whiskey-making amidst a beautiful natural backdrop.
Beans Creek Winery:
Beans Creek Winery is an award-winning winery producing top-quality wine. Visitors can enjoy a tasting of the wines while overlooking the stunning vineyards.
Morrison Chapel:
Morrison Chapel is an awe-inspiring structure that represents Manchester's deep religious roots. The historic church features unique architecture, stained glass windows, and awe-inspiring wooden pews.
Main Street Shopping District:
If shopping is your thing, The Main Street Shopping District is a hub for all kinds of shops, boutiques, and restaurants in Manchester. Visitors can immersively engage in the local culture, artwork, and cuisine.
Manchester Coffee County Conference Center:
The Manchester Coffee County Conference Center hosts numerous events and meetings. Its stunning architecture, modern technology, and spacious accommodations are sure to impress visitors.
